Indonesia readies social aid scheme through village cooperatives
Jakarta, July 24 -- The Ministry of Social Affairs is preparing a regulatory framework and implementation schemes to support plans for integrating social assistance and welfare initiatives with the Red and White Village Cooperatives (KDMP) program.
Minister Saifullah Yusuf said his office is working on mechanisms to enable village cooperatives to improve public access to improve access to government welfare initiatives, such as the Family Hope Program (PKH).
He made the statement after attending an event marking the 59th anniversary of the Indonesian National Council for Social Welfare in Jakarta on Friday.
